To appreciate the value of a submersible LED aquarium light, we must first recognize the limitations of traditional above-water lighting. Surface-mounted fixtures, while common, often struggle to distribute light evenly throughout the tank. Light intensity diminishes rapidly with depth, leaving lower levels dim and shadowed-bad news for bottom-dwelling fish, rooted plants, or decorations that deserve to be seen. These fixtures also face waterproofing challenges: splashes, condensation, or accidental submersion can damage internal components, risking electrical hazards or premature failure. For planted tanks, uneven light leads to patchy growth-some plants stretch toward the surface, while others languish in darkness. For fish tanks, dim lower levels hide the natural behaviors and colors of species that prefer deeper waters. The submersible LED light solves these issues by placing the light source directly in the water, ensuring consistent brightness from top to bottom, while its waterproof design eliminates the risk of damage from moisture. It's a simple yet transformative shift: instead of light struggling to penetrate water, water becomes the medium through which light flows, creating a more natural, immersive environment.

 

At the core of the Submersible LED Aquarium Light's appeal is its advanced waterproof design, engineered to thrive in fully submerged conditions. Unlike above-water lights that rely on basic splash guards, these submersible models are built to withstand continuous immersion, with IP68 ratings-the highest waterproof standard, meaning they're dust-tight and can be submerged beyond 1 meter for extended periods. This level of protection is achieved through sealed casings, waterproof gaskets, and epoxy-coated LED chips that prevent water intrusion. For UK users, the inclusion of a UK plug (fitted with a 3-pin BS 1363 plug) ensures compatibility with standard UK sockets, while adherence to safety certifications like UKCA and CE guarantees that the light meets strict electrical and waterproofing standards, reducing the risk of short circuits or electric shock. This focus on safety is critical, as submersible lights operate in direct contact with water, making robust engineering non-negotiable for both user and aquatic life safety.

 

Beyond waterproofing, the submersible LED light's bar stick design enhances light distribution in ways surface fixtures can't match. Shaped as a slim, elongated bar or stick, it fits easily along the back, side, or bottom of the tank (depending on mounting options), casting light horizontally through the water column. This eliminates the "spotlight effect" of above-water lights, where brightness is concentrated directly below the fixture and fades quickly at the edges. Instead, the submersible bar emits light 360 degrees (in some models) or in a wide beam, ensuring that even deep tanks or tanks with dense plant growth receive uniform illumination. The slim profile-often just 1–2 cm in diameter-avoids disrupting the tank's aesthetic, blending into the background while highlighting fish, plants, and decor. Whether in a 10-gallon desktop tank or a 100-gallon community tank, the bar stick design scales to fit, with lengths ranging from 30 cm to 120 cm to match different tank sizes.

 

The three lighting modes of this submersible LED light add a layer of versatility that caters to the dynamic needs of aquarium ecosystems throughout the day. Mode 1, often labeled "Plant Growth," emphasizes blue (400–500 nm) and red (600–700 nm) wavelengths, mirroring the spectrum aquatic plants need for photosynthesis. This mode fuels growth in species like Amazon swords, Java fern, and dwarf hairgrass, reducing reliance on expensive CO2 systems by ensuring plants can efficiently convert light into energy. Mode 2, typically "Daylight Display," shifts to a balanced spectrum with added white light (5000K–6500K), enhancing color rendition for fish and decor. This mode brings out the iridescence in bettas, the bold stripes of tiger barbs, and the texture of driftwood or rocks, making the tank visually striking during daytime viewing. Mode 3, often "Nighttime Dim," uses soft, low-intensity blue or violet light (around 450 nm) that mimics moonlight. This allows for nighttime observation without disrupting fish sleep cycles, as most aquatic species are less sensitive to blue light, reducing stress compared to sudden bright light in the dark.

 

Energy efficiency and heat management are additional strengths of the Submersible LED Aquarium Light. LEDs consume up to 80% less energy than incandescent or fluorescent lights, a crucial advantage for lights that may run 8–12 hours daily. Their low heat output is even more critical in submersible applications: excessive heat can raise water temperatures, stressing fish and altering water chemistry. Submersible LEDs emit minimal heat, with most models generating so little that they don't affect water temperature, even during extended use. This contrasts with older submersible incandescent lights, which often overheated, requiring strict usage limits. With a lifespan of 25,000–50,000 hours, these LEDs also outlast traditional bulbs by years, reducing the need for frequent replacements-a significant benefit when changing a submersible light requires draining part of the tank or disconnecting waterproof connections.

 

Installation and flexibility are key to the submersible LED light's user-friendly design. Most models come with mounting options like strong suction cups or adjustable brackets, allowing secure attachment to glass or acrylic tank walls. This versatility lets users position the light at different depths: near the surface to highlight floating plants, mid-tank to illuminate swimming fish, or near the substrate to support carpeting plants. For larger tanks, multiple light bars can be installed in parallel to ensure full coverage. The UK plug simplifies setup in British homes, requiring no additional adapters, while a generous power cord (often 1.5–2 meters) provides flexibility in placing the tank away from sockets. Some advanced models include a separate control box outside the tank, allowing users to switch modes or adjust brightness without touching the submerged light-adding convenience while maintaining waterproof integrity.

 

The Submersible LED Aquarium Light excels across diverse tank types, adapting to the needs of planted tanks, fish-only setups, and even small reef environments. In planted tanks, the "Plant Growth" mode ensures that rooted plants receive sufficient light at all depths, preventing the leggy growth that occurs when lower leaves are starved of light. In fish-only tanks, the "Daylight Display" mode enhances natural colors, making species like discus or angelfish appear more vibrant while revealing subtle patterns in otherwise plain-looking catfish or loaches. For nano reef tanks, specialized versions of these lights include UV wavelengths in their "Daylight" mode, supporting coral health and triggering the fluorescence in zoanthids or acroporas, creating a stunning visual effect. The "Nighttime Dim" mode benefits all tank types by providing low-light visibility without disrupting the diurnal rhythms of fish, which rely on dark periods for rest and stress reduction.

 

When selecting a Submersible LED Aquarium Light, several factors ensure optimal performance. First, prioritize waterproof rating: confirm it's IP68 certified, as lower ratings (like IP67) are only temporary submersion-resistant. Second, evaluate the three modes to ensure they align with your tank's needs: "Plant Growth" should emphasize blue/red, "Display" should include white light (CRI 80+ for natural color), and "Night" should be low-intensity blue/violet. Third, match the light bar length to your tank: a 60 cm tank pairs well with a 50–60 cm light, while a 120 cm tank may need a 100–120 cm bar or two shorter bars. Fourth, check for safety certifications: UKCA, CE, and RoHS compliance ensure the light is free of harmful substances and meets electrical safety standards. Finally, consider brightness, measured in PAR (Photosynthetically Active Radiation): 20–50 PAR suits low-light plants, 50–100 PAR for medium to high-light species, and adjustability is ideal for customizing intensity.

 

Maintenance of a submersible LED light is straightforward but requires attention to preserve waterproof performance. Regularly inspect the light's casing for cracks or damage, especially around the power cord entry point, where water could seep in. Clean the light's surface periodically with a soft, damp cloth (while disconnected) to remove algae or mineral deposits that block light output. Avoid using harsh chemicals, as they can degrade waterproof seals. When replacing the light after its long lifespan, ensure the new model has the same waterproof rating and mounting compatibility to avoid leaks. For smart models with external controllers, keep the control box dry and dust-free to prevent connectivity issues.

 

Common misconceptions about submersible LED lights often center on safety and performance. A prevalent myth is that submersible lights are prone to electric shock, but modern models with UKCA/CE certification and IP68 ratings undergo rigorous testing to prevent this, with insulated wiring and fail-safe designs. Another misconception is that submersible lights are harder to install than surface lights, but suction cups and plug-and-play UK sockets make setup simple for most users. Some hobbyists also worry that submerged lights will overheat the water, but LEDs produce minimal heat, and their low wattage (typically 10–30W) ensures they don't affect tank temperature, even in small 5-gallon setups.
